    Calidad en Educación Superior y Orientación: Eficacia de un Seminario de Gestión Personal de la Carrera para Pre Graduados
    (2014-08-01) Céu Taveira, María do; Nazaré Loureiro, María de
    Career services and interventions based on research and empirical evidence are progressively considered mechanisms for quality assurance in higher education. We present a study on the effectiveness of a career self-management seminar designed for help undergraduates prepare for next life career changes and goal attainment. Four hundred and twenty eight students with an age mean of 22 years old (n=208 experimental group; n=220 control group) attending university and polytechnic higher institutions in the northwestern Portugal, were assessed by the Career Exploration Survey, the Career Development Inventory and My Vocational Situation according to a pretest and posttest design. The Seminar is research based and comprises nine weekly small group sessions of 120 minutes each which facilitate students' career planning, in-depth exploration, goal implementation and feedback competences. Results indicate significant differences between experimental and control groups, with increase in most of the career dimensions, among the experimental group. The career seminar produced a medium mean effect size of .53. The intervention positively affected undergraduates' career self-management processual behaviors.

    Oferta de los servicios de orientación en las universidades españolas
    (Universidad de Murcia. Servicio de Publicaciones, 2002) Vidal, Javier; Díez, Gloria M.; Vieira, M. José
    Inany educational system, guidance and counselling are considered as a hallmark of quality. Since the 1980s, while there has been a dramatic increase in the range of choices on  offer in universities throughout Spain, it has become more difficult to enter the work force. Consequently, there has been a growth in the number of Guidance and Counselling Services aimed at helping students in decision making throughout their years at university. This study describes Guidance and Counselling Services and pinpoints innovations and improvement actions implemented in these services at Spanish universities in order to facilitate information that might be helpful in improving the system. Two sources of information have been used: institutional web sites and telephone interviews with persons in charge of Spanish university Guidance and Counselling Services.

    Tutoría universitaria y servicios de orientación: Dos realidades en un mismo contexto
    (2015-04-16) Pérez Cusó, Francisco Javier; Martínez Juárez, Miriam
    La orientación del alumnado universitario se ha convertido en los últimos años tanto en un elemento de calidad como en un derecho refrendado por el propio Estatuto del Estudiante Universitario. En la universidad española conviven diferentes modos de dar respuesta a las necesidades de información, apoyo y orientación: por un lado los servicios de orientación y por otro la tutoría. Este trabajo busca profundizar en la información de la que disponen y la utilización que realizan los estudiantes en torno a estos dos modos de organizar la orientación universitaria. Los resultados sugieren la necesidad de un mayor esfuerzo de planificación, coordinación e integración, así como de difusión de las diferentes acciones de orientación realizadas.
